How they compare
Rwanda currently reports 98,000 m3 against 84,253 m3 in Albania, a difference of 13,747 m3.
That makes Rwanda's figure about 1.2 times Albania's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 27 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Rwanda ahead.
Albania ranks 80th and Rwanda ranks 79th of 134 countries.
Rwanda has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
